Output 7ad3551a406f79aa8cb3d755a0d53d7cce1c7a3a1898f02b5f8bb83428f05091:2

value
29490000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5c83808f1ab0c6b10f1b67e9b8e1ba4980daeb1 OP_EQUAL
address
3MBPhrazg47hkCqRqWoJ8CXcUeQLUgwgqB
transaction
7ad3551a406f79aa8cb3d755a0d53d7cce1c7a3a1898f02b5f8bb83428f05091
spent
true